386.40—What are the requirements for scholars?

A scholar—
(a) Shall receive the training at the educational institution or agency designated in the scholarship; and
(b) Shall not accept payment of educational allowances from any other Federal, State, or local public or private nonprofit agency if that allowance conflicts with the individual's obligation under § 386.33(a)(4) or § 386.34(c)(1).
(c) Shall enter into a written agreement with the grantee, before starting training, that meets the terms and conditions required in § 386.34 ;
(d) Shall be enrolled in a course of study leading to a certificate or degree in one of the fields designated in § 386.1(b); and
(e) Shall maintain satisfactory progress toward the certificate or degree as determined by the grantee.
